New to kickboxing? Start at Apex Muay Thai - Omaha
Apex Muay Thai - Omaha comes up as a beginner-friendly gym, going by their listing and members’ reviews. If you've never thrown a punch or a kick, that's exactly who a good beginners class is for. A few things worth knowing before your first week. First, you don't need to be fit or coordinated to start — you get in shape by training, not before it, and coaches scale every drill to you. Second, you won't be thrown into hard sparring — reputable gyms build the basics (stance, footwork, and punches and kicks on pads and bags) first, and any contact eases in gradually under a coach's control. Third, all fitness levels really are welcome — ask about a dedicated beginners or fundamentals class time so your first session is alongside others who are also starting out. Most gyms are happy to let you watch or try a class first, so reach out before you commit.
Your first kickboxing class at Apex Muay Thai - Omaha
Nervous about walking into a kickboxing gym for the first time? Almost everyone is, and good coaches expect be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a warm-up, then drilling the basics — stance, footwork, and punches and kicks on pads or a heavy bag — not hard sparring. Go at your own pace and rest whenever you need to; no one will bat an eye. What to wear: comfortable athletic clothes you can move and sweat in, and supportive trainers. What to bring: water, and hand wraps and gloves if you have them — many gyms lend loaner gloves for a first class, so it's worth asking when you call. As you keep training you'll add your own gloves and wraps (and shin guards once you start sparring). Sparring is optional and eases in gradually, once your basics are solid.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to sign a waiver and meet the coach. It gets easier fast — most people feel far more at home by their third class.
